## Formula sandbox tuning

User-supplied formulas in Gridmoor execute inside a restricted interpreter with hard ceilings on time, memory, and call depth. Reviewers should confirm any change to these ceilings is justified in the PR description, since raising them widens the abuse surface. Defaults were chosen from production traces. The current limits are as follows.

limits module of tafog-fawip:
WEIGHTS = {
    "julix": 57,
    "lamys": 992,
    "kasvan": 209,
    "quenok": 750,
    "alddor": 259,
    "oliath": 1009,
    "wenix": 815,
}

## Break-Glass: Templar Rendering Cache

Support: if Templar's template renderer degrades (p95 over 2s), break-glass lets you flush the compiled-template cache directly. Use only after paging on-call fails. Steps: open the ops shell, run `templar-flush --force`, confirm twice. The shell gates the force flag behind an emergency unlock; supply the recovery passphrase below.

strongbox words: zorox-holix

Subject: Decision on Harwick plant capacity

All,

After reviewing the Q2 utilization figures, leadership has decided to expand line capacity at the Harwick facility rather than outsource overflow to Dunmore Fabrication. Capex approval is pending final sign-off from Elias Thorn. Staffing will add one full shift starting in autumn. Department heads should model the impact on their budgets by Friday. The confidential rationale is summarized directly below.

confidential, yagep-kagef: Rusvanox Holdings is in early talks to buy Julwynix Systems for about $454.5 million. The Fenael launch date is April 23, and nothing goes to the press before then. Legal wants the Druwynix Works term sheet redrafted before January 8.